Abstract

A laminated and stacked cleaning kit consists of a plurality of cleaning elements stacking together. Each of the cleaning elements contains cleaning material for bonding the cleaning elements together in a laminated fashion. When in use for cleaning, the cleaning elements can generate fine foams and bubbles to achieve deep layer cleaning effect for the cleaning object. When the cleaning material on the cleaning element at the outmost layer is consumed, the outmost cleaning element peels off naturally and may be discarded. When use at the next time, the clean cleaning element at the next layer may be used.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is:  
     
         1 . A laminated and stacked cleaning kit comprising: 
 a plurality of cleaning elements stacked over one another to form a bar; and    a cleaning material contained in the cleaning elements to bond the cleaning elements together;    wherein after the cleaning material on the cleaning element at the outmost layer is consumed, the cleaning element peels off naturally for discarding.    
     
     
         2 . The laminated and stacked cleaning kit of  claim 1 , wherein the cleaning elements have housing cavities formed on same locations that connect to each other.  
     
     
         3 . The laminated and stacked cleaning kit of  claim 1 , wherein the cleaning elements are formed in laminates which have non-smooth surfaces.  
     
     
         4 . The laminated and stacked cleaning kit of  claim 1 , wherein the cleaning elements are formed in mesh elements.  
     
     
         5 . The laminated and stacked cleaning kit of  claim 1 , wherein the cleaning elements are made from a blowing material.  
     
     
         6 . The laminated and stacked cleaning kit of  claim 1 , wherein the cleaning elements are made from cloths.  
     
     
         7 . The laminated and stacked cleaning kit of  claim 1 , wherein the cleaning kit is housed in a holder which has a bottom pivotally coupled with an extendable means which has a rotary strut and is covered by a cap.  
     
     
         8 . A laminated and stacked cleaning kit comprising: 
 a plurality of cleaning elements stacked over one another to form a bar, each of the cleaning elements having a bottom coupled with a water-proof layer; and    a cleaning material contained in the cleaning elements;    wherein after the cleaning material on the cleaning element at the outmost layer is consumed, the cleaning element peels off naturally for discarding.    
     
     
         9 . The laminated and stacked cleaning kit of  claim 8 , wherein the bar type cleaning kit formed by the stacked cleaning elements is covered by a water-proof layer on the periphery thereof.
